Downer Site Services employs several advanced concrete techniques designed to enhance durability and sustainability. One significant approach is the use of high-performance concrete (HPC). HPC is formulated to withstand extreme conditions, offering increased lifespan to bridges, roads, and urban structures, thereby reducing the need for frequent repairs. This not only results in cost savings for municipalities and developers but also minimizes traffic disruptions and enhances public safety.
Another technique utilized by Downer Site Services is the integration of supplementary cementitious materials (SCMs) into concrete mixes. SCMs, such as fly ash and slag, reduce the reliance on traditional cement, thereby cutting down carbon dioxide emissions. This innovation is pivotal as cities worldwide aim to reduce their environmental impact and move towards greener practices. The implementation of SCMs in urban infrastructure helps align with these sustainability goals while maintaining the uncompromised strength of concrete.
The incorporation of fiber-reinforced concrete is yet another hallmark of Downer Site Services' strategy. This technique involves adding fibers, usually made of steel or synthetic materials, to the concrete mix. The result is a composite material that boasts enhanced tensile strength and flexibility, making it particularly suitable for areas prone to seismic activity or heavy traffic loads. By preventing cracks and structural damage, fiber-reinforced concrete prolongs the endurance of vital infrastructure, bolstering urban resilience in the face of natural disasters and heavy use.
